github taers232c/GAMADV-XTD3 v6.67.37
GAM 6.67.37

latest releases: v7.00.38, v7.00.37, v7.0036...
9 months ago

Scroll to bottom of page for installation/downloads

Latest updates

6.67.37

Fixed bug in gam <UserTypeEntity> show messages ... showattachments to avoid a trap when text/plain attachments
in character sets other than UTF-8 are displayed.

6.67.36

Updated gam batch <BatchContent> and gam tbatch <BatchContent> commands to accept lines with the following form:

sleep <Integer>

Batch processing will suspend for <Integer> seconds before the next command line is processed.

6.67.35

Added the following options to <PermissionMatch> that allow more powerful matching.

nottype <DriveFileACLType>
typelist <DriveFileACLTypeList>
nottypelist <DriveFileACLTypeList>
rolelist <DriveFileACLRoleList>
notrolelist <DriveFileACLRoleList>

6.67.34

Added option movetoorgunitdelay <Integer> to gam <UserTypeEntity> create shareddrive <Name> ... ou|org|orgunit <OrgUnitItem>.
GAM creates the Shared Drive, verifies that it has been created and then tries to move it to <OrgUnitItem>. Google seems to
require a delay or the following error is generated.

ERROR: 409: 409 - The operation was aborted.

movetoorgunitdelay defaults to 20 seconds which seems to work; <Integer> can range from 0 to 60.

6.67.33

Upgraded to OpenSSL 3.2.1 where possible.

Fixed bug in gam <UserTypeEntity> print shareddrives where role was improperly displayed as fileOrganizer
rather than writer.

Added option guiroles [<Boolean>] to gam <UserTypeEntity> info|print|show shareddrive that maps
the Drive API role names to the Google Drive GUI role names.

API: GUI
commenter: Commenter
fileOrganizer: Content manager
organizer: Manager
reader: Viewer
writer: Contributor

6.67.32

Updated <ToDriveAttribute> to allow multiple tdshare <EmailAddress> commenter|reader|writer options.

Fixed bug in gam <UserTypeEntity> print shareddrives where role was improperly displayed as unknown
rather than reader when Allow viewers and commenters to download, print, and copy files was unchecked for the Shared Drive.

6.67.31

Updated gam <UserTypeEntity> claim|transfer ownership <DriveFileEntity> to properly
handle the case where <DriveFileEntity> referencess a Drive shortcut.

6.67.30

Fixed bug where the fullpath option in various commands was not converting the generic shared drive name Drive to the drive's actual name.

6.67.29

Added optional argument owneraccess to gam courses <CourseEntity> remove teachers|students [owneracccess] <UserTypeEntity and
gam course <CourseID> remove teacher|student [owneraccess] <EmailAddress> in order to test a possible API change.

Updated code to avoid a trap when gam config auto_batch_min 1 csv file.csv gam ... was entered.
The config auto_batch_min 1 is not appropriate in this context and will be ignored.

6.67.28

Improved handling of Bad Request error in gam <UserTypeEntity> collect orphans.

6.67.27

Updated gam <UserTypeEntity> collect orphans to handle the following error:

ERROR: 400: badRequest - Bad Request

6.67.26

Fixed bug in gam print vaultexports ... formatjson that caused a trap.

6.67.25

Added option owneraccess to gam info courses <CourseEntity> and gam info course <CourseID> in order
to test a possible API change.

6.67.24

Fixed bug that caused HTML password notification email messages to be displayed in raw form.

6.67.23

Use local copy of googleapiclient to remove static discovery documents to improve performance.

6.67.22

Added permissionidlist <PermissionIDList> to <PermissionMatch> that allows matching any permission ID in a list.

Added option exportlinkeddrivefiles <Boolean> to gam create vaultexport that is used with corpus mail.

6.67.21

Updated gam remove aliases <EmailAddress> user|group <EmailAddressEntity> to give a more informative
error message when the target/alias combination does not exist.

Old: User: testsimple@rdschool.org, User Alias: tsalias@rdschool.org, Remove Failed: Invalid Input: resource_id
New: User: testsimple@rdschool.org, User Alias: tsalias@rdschool.org, Remove Failed: Does not exist

Installation

If you are a first time Gam user:

If you are updating your GAMADV-XTD3 version:

If you are upgrading from standard Gam

If you are upgrading from GAMADV-X or GAMADV-XTD

sha256 hashes

2c124f55ab14f6c62468d3a392b79717666f2c25212d13e9e3ea163ee12c3f86  gamadv-xtd3-6.67.37-linux-arm64-glibc2.23.tar.xz
eb9022f8e19fc3f43d0b0bb6293d3fe209717af284a9a1868f51fdd01bebde2e  gamadv-xtd3-6.67.37-linux-arm64-glibc2.27.tar.xz
d3e23aa29000d7372e8865f1506bac67406934baa76727ce044142ba3a53ad50  gamadv-xtd3-6.67.37-linux-arm64-glibc2.31.tar.xz
55c969a90460adbd8a75f3c1971221d7dd894043cf6bf8fae54484140d9b042e  gamadv-xtd3-6.67.37-linux-x86_64-glibc2.19.tar.xz
8318b241f42bb5df8ad6e1a73e376104be4a2f8114bd95788eefeb547c2005be  gamadv-xtd3-6.67.37-linux-x86_64-glibc2.23.tar.xz
193aa205b69678d9eb28f559399b5d3179baa837fef331ce69a53941604d2d95  gamadv-xtd3-6.67.37-linux-x86_64-glibc2.27.tar.xz
c963369581072560b104cf1c9f0169ac8ec9d2af0e694be4f29be3441ff423ec  gamadv-xtd3-6.67.37-linux-x86_64-glibc2.31.tar.xz
3fdbb7fcf93bf22f9ce73d625441aab0b39e88e4816dd15dc9b704d45a25c8ea  gamadv-xtd3-6.67.37-linux-x86_64-glibc2.35.tar.xz
9d224df16fa56a65ae4630a656121632536c4818160a1e0ab417582b8950194b  gamadv-xtd3-6.67.37-linux-x86_64-legacy.tar.xz
e041eb51d535ba1d178d27c9d0efb0e53df8f0aab2534613410244413e99e3b5  gamadv-xtd3-6.67.37-macos-arm64.tar.xz
8726bcece5729f5bb046d3beaa31652489ad12fbba85d5481196239984583694  gamadv-xtd3-6.67.37-macos-x86_64.tar.xz
63f31bf2b2086f33e51e77de9e5d688a223294b1279ae0c162a664b091a72d33  gamadv-xtd3-6.67.37-windows-x86_64.msi
fcfcc27192855d303207a46b156de7478a831b3dc0170aa69284d9c0de0bded1  gamadv-xtd3-6.67.37-windows-x86_64.zip

Don't miss a new GAMADV-XTD3 release

NewReleases is sending notifications on new releases.